Description

This form is used by a tenant to inform the landlord of a problem with the lease premises, specifically that the lights and wiring do not work and are unsafe. With this form, the tenant notifies the landlord that he/she/it has breached the statutory duty to maintain the property in tenantable condition and demands that immediate repairs be made.

Title: Tampa Florida Letter from Tenant to Landlord with Demand for Repairs of Unsafe or Broken Lights and Wiring Dear [Landlord's Name], I hope this letter finds you well. I am writing to bring to your attention an urgent matter that requires your immediate attention. As a responsible tenant in one of your properties located in Tampa, Florida, I would like to request immediate repairs to remedy the unsafe or broken lights and wiring within the premises. It has come to my attention that there are several lights and electrical fixtures throughout the unit that are either malfunctioning, completely broken, or pose a significant safety risk. I believe it is crucial for these issues to be addressed promptly to ensure the safety and well-being of all occupants. Specifically, I have identified the following areas of concern that require immediate attention: 1. Non-functioning Lights: In various rooms, such as the living room, kitchen, and bathroom, several light fixtures are not functioning properly, leaving the areas inadequately lit. This poses a safety hazard as it increases the likelihood of accidents or injuries. 2. Flickering Lights: In addition to the non-functioning lights, there are instances where lights flicker intermittently or exhibit abnormal behavior. This not only creates an unpleasant living environment but also raises concerns about potential fire hazards or electrical failures. 3. Faulty Electrical Outlets: Some electrical outlets within the unit are either non-operational or exhibit signs of wear and tear. These faulty outlets not only disrupt the residents' ability to use electrical devices but also pose a fire risk. 4. Exposed or Damaged Wiring: I have noticed instances where wiring is exposed or visibly damaged, putting occupants at risk of electric shocks and fires. This poses a severe safety concern that must be addressed immediately. I kindly request that you take the necessary steps to remedy these issues within the shortest possible time frame. Considering the potential risks associated with faulty lights and wiring, I believe it is in everyone's best interest to resolve this matter urgently. As per our rental agreement, I would like to remind you that it is your responsibility as the landlord to ensure the premises are properly maintained and comply with all safety standards. Given the current circumstances, I trust that you will prioritize these repairs to ensure the safety of all tenants. I kindly request that you provide a written response within the next [reasonable timeframe, e.g., five business days] to acknowledge receipt of this letter and confirm that action will be taken to address the aforementioned problems promptly. Thank you for your immediate attention to this matter. I believe that by working together, we can ensure a safe and comfortable living environment for all. Sincerely, [Your Name] [Your Address] [City, State, ZIP Code] [Email Address] [Phone Number] Variations: 1.
